DRV8801EVM: Motor Driver Evaluation Module from Texas Instruments
The DRV8801EVM from Texas Instruments is an exemplary evaluation module that provides designers with a robust platform for testing and developing applications using the DRV8801 Single Brushed DC Motor Driver IC. This compact, high-performance module is specifically designed to drive a single brushed DC motor, making it an ideal tool for a wide range of projects in robotics, industrial control, and automation.
Key Features
- Integrated DRV8801 motor driver capable of delivering up to 2.8A of output current.
- Operates from a 8V to 36V supply voltage range, catering to various power requirements.
- Features a PH/EN (Phase/Enable) control interface for straightforward and efficient motor direction and speed regulation.
- Incorporates built-in protection features such as overcurrent, thermal shutdown, and under-voltage lockout, ensuring safe operation under diverse conditions.
- Comes with jumpers and connectors that provide flexible options for quick setup and interfacing with external control hardware.
- Includes a power-good LED indicator, which provides visual feedback on the operational status of the module.
